Editors' Comments

The 3.2-megapixel Sony CyberShot DSC-P72 is ideal for photographers in search of a simple point & shoot with a very capable video mode. Offering the convenience of AA batteries (Sony has even taken the unusual step of including a charger) and the added benefit of a high resolution movie mode limited only by the size of the Memory Stick, the P72 should... read more

Specifications

  • 3.2 megapixels (effective)
  • 3x optical zoom/3.2x digital zoom
  • auto and preset manual focus
  • program and manual exposure
  • JPEG file format only
  • ISO range 100 - 400

Professional Reviews

  • 3.8 out of 5
Delivers both quick shooting and vivid snapshots (CNET - 1/22/04)

Quick shot-to-shot time, long movies, and ease-of-use make the Sony CyberShot DSC-P72 a good camera for taking quick snapshots. The camera's poor low-light performance lowers its score, however. read original review

  • 4.8 out of 5
Images are excellent (Steve's Digicams - 7/10/03)

There are very few complaints in this review of the Sony DSC-P72 -- the camera's AA batteries, non-glare LCD, autofocus illuminator, and small size make it a great point & shoot camera. read original review

  • 4.7 out of 5
Absolutely worth a look. (DC Resource - 7/10/03)

Good images, an excellent movie mode, and quick shot-to-shot time earn the Sony DSC-P72 an endorsement as a very good point & shoot camera. read original review
